Pear Recruitment Assistant Lettings Manager - Waterloo

Monday Friday 9am 6pm

Salary £27,000 - £32,000, OTE £55,000 - £60,000

Our client is looking for an enthusiastic individual to join their growing team as an Assistant Lettings Manager, based out of their vibrant office in a great part of central London. Their teams in China and Hong Kong meet clients in person and win new business for the London office to manage. The ideal candidate will be experienced and be able to demonstrate exceptional customer service skills. A professional approach, excellent communication, and an ability to work on your own initiative will be essential. Readyto help mentor the team, an excellent Valuer, you will lead by example with your strong negotiation skills. This is an amazing opportunity for a hardworking, reliable, and approachable Assistant Lettings Manager who is looking for success way into the future.

Key Benefits:
- Progressive work environment.
- Join a well-integrated team where cooperation and mutual support are the norms.
- Engage in a diverse range of tasks, from valuations and landlord relations to overseeing the letting team and handling end-of-tenancy processes.
- Play a crucial role in maintaining high levels of client satisfaction


Skills and Experience Required:
- Demonstrable experience in a similar role within the lettings industry.
- Strong leadership skills to assist with managing and motivate the lettings team effectively.
- Meticulous attention to detail
- Excellent interpersonal skills
- Proficiency in managing lettings accounts
